Big Sky Day 3-Charles Hulme and Maggie Snowling- Nickie Dubbs and Patti Durgan/Oral Language screening to practice (135)
Send us a text Charles Hulme and Maggie Snowling share decades of research on reading development, dyslexia, and oral language. They explain why knowing how to teach is as vital as what to teach, clear up myths that can derail instruction, and spotlight evidence from interventions like NELI. Research shows that boosting spoken language early provides children with more resources to apply during independent and teacher directed learning, leading to stronger reading and broader academic success...

Listen Again-What Should PA Instruction Look Like? Tiffany Peltier, and Marianne Rice PhD
Send us a text The One About… What Should PA Instruction Look Like? Tiffany Peltier, and Marianne Rice PhD Quote: “The case for using letters in PA instruction is stacking up higher & higher… New research out today: An upside-down U curve found for oral PA instruction (diminishing returns after less than 10hrs) but the OPPOSITE—increasingly MORE returns after 16 hrs—for PA w/LETTERS ��” Tiffany Peltier, PhD Tiffany Peltier bio: Tiffany Peltier is a Research Scientist in the Collaborat...
